Hughesnet is a widely-used satellite internet service that can be used in Los Angeles or any suburban area nearby. Satellite net can bring about high-speed wide-area net connectivity where cable or DSL could be unavailable. It can take longer to access online data, and that makes it not a preferred platform for activities that require a fast internet connection. But as to satellite internet, it is highly effective for handling fundamental internet searching, emailing, and video streaming in standard definition; and also for servers where you want to download large files. The Hughesnet services and hardware expenses are generally high as compared to some other internet service providers. However, having a high-speed internet access without a phone or cable makes Hughesnet equally appealing for most off-grid households and businesses in LA suburbs or far-off areas. HughesNet is making it easy to stay connected, offering soft data limits in all internet plans. Even if you have exceeded the allotted volume, your connection won't cut out - only slowing down speeds from 10-100 Mbps to a maximum of 3Mbps until the end of that month!
